Alcohol Sensitivity
The degree to which an individual reacts to the consumption of alcohol, which can vary greatly among different people.
Metabolism
The set of life-sustaining chemical reactions in organisms that enable the conversion of food to energy, the construction of proteins and nucleic acids, and the elimination of nitrogenous wastes.
DSM
The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ders, a handbook used by healthcare professionals as the authoritative guide to the diagnosis of mental disorders.
Depression
A mental disorder characterized by persistent sadness, loss of interest in activities, and the inability to experience pleasure, affecting one's thoughts, behavior, feelings, and sense of well-being.
